Dual Voice Modes, 8 Customizable Buttons & Exclusive Grip Handle:It features a boy/girl voice switch for relatable interaction, plus 8 programmable buttons to record personalized commands (e.g., dialects or family nicknames). The exclusive right-side grip handle ensures stable holding for kids with fine motor challenges and stroke patients with limb weakness—an unique advantage over standard AAC communication tools. Adjustable Volume & Travel-Friendly for Multi-Scenario Use:With stepless adjustable volume, it works clearly in noisy classrooms, rehab clinics or public places. The lightweight body, matching storage bag and ergonomic grip make it ideal for on-the-go speech therapy (requires 3 AAA batteries, not included)—a top choice for portable non-verbal communication aids.
